What is Elderly day care?

Day care is support during the day for people living at home, including those living with dementia. Your loved one joins us in the morning and returns home later that day.

At Hale Place, we take time to understand the person and what helps them feel comfortable. Some people love joining in. Others prefer a quieter day with one-to-one company. There’s no pressure, just a calm routine, good food, and small, happy moments.

Who is it for?

Day care is for people living at home who would benefit from company, a warm meal, and a little structure to the day. It can also help when memory changes mean the day feels more confusing or lonely.

It’s often a relief for families too, whether you’re working, managing appointments, or simply need time to rest.

Day care can also be a gentle introduction to Hale Place. It lets your loved one get to know the home and the team at their own pace, with no pressure.

Our Approach

We create a calm, friendly day where people can enjoy company and feel part of something. Some people like to join in with group activities. Others prefer quieter time, a chat, or simply sitting peacefully.

There are opportunities for music, gentle movement, games, arts and crafts, time outdoors and occasional outings when they feel right. What matters most is that each day is shaped around the person, not a timetable.

Help is always there when it’s needed, offered with dignity, warmth and respect. We take time to understand what makes someone feel comfortable and settled, so even a single day can include small, happy moments.

How many days a week can my loved one attend day care?

Day care at Hale Place is flexible. Some people come one day a week for company and a change of scene. Others attend several days for more consistent support. We’ll talk it through with you and find what fits your loved one’s needs and your family’s routine.

How is a day care place arranged?

Start by getting in touch. We’ll have a relaxed chat to understand what you need and whether day care feels like the right fit. If it does, we’ll arrange a visit and take you through the next steps in plain English.

Is day care at Hale Place suitable for someone in the later stages of dementia?

It can be, depending on the person and what support they need day to day. Talk to us about your loved one’s situation and we’ll be honest about whether day care is the right option, and what we can put in place to support them safely and comfortably.
